Begrenzen vs. beschränken vs. einschränken
In German, the words begrenzen, beschränken, and einschränken all relate to the idea of limiting or restricting something, but they differ in nuance and usage. Understanding these differences can make communication more precise and natural in various contexts.
Begrenzen
B1Begrenzen means to set a boundary or define a limit for something. It often refers to physical boundaries, temporal constraints, or numerical limits.
Wir müssen die Anzahl der Teilnehmer auf 50 begrenzen.
(We must limit the number of participants to 50.)
Das Baugebiet ist durch den Fluss nach Westen begrenzt.
(The construction area is bounded by the river to the west.)
Die Unterrichtszeit ist auf zwei Stunden begrenzt.
(The class time is limited to two hours.)
Beschränken
B2Beschränken focuses on imposing a restriction or a constraint, often in a non-physical or regulatory sense. It suggests curbing or constraining activities, rights, or actions.
Die neuen Gesetze beschränken die Bewegungsfreiheit.
(The new laws restrict freedom of movement.)
Er beschränkt sich auf das Wesentliche in seiner Präsentation.
(He limits himself to the essentials in his presentation.)
Die Nutzung von Wasser wurde während der Dürre stark beschränkt.
(The use of water was heavily restricted during the drought.)
Einschränken
B1Einschränken suggests a reduction or partial limitation, often implying a loss of freedom or scope. It can indicate limiting one's own actions or choices, often due to external circumstances.
Wir müssen unsere Ausgaben deutlich einschränken.
(We need to significantly reduce our expenses.)
Nach dem Unfall musste sie ihre sportlichen Aktivitäten einschränken.
(After the accident, she had to limit her sports activities.)
Das schlechte Wetter hat unsere Möglichkeiten stark eingeschränkt.
(The bad weather severely limited our options.)
Summary
The words begrenzen, beschränken, and einschränken share the idea of limiting something but differ in their focus and nuances. Begrenzen emphasizes a clear boundary or limit, often numerical or physical. Beschränken refers to imposing restrictions or constraints, often in a regulatory or abstract context. Einschränken highlights a partial or self-imposed limitation, often influenced by external circumstances.
